Expect some delays this week on Route 6 near the New Bedford-Fairhaven Bridge.

Erin Lopes, the Water Registrar for the City of New Bedford, told WBSM News the west side of the bridge, the side heading into Fairhaven, will be closed Monday, Tuesday, and Wednesday night.

The closures will begin at 7 p.m. and last until 7 a.m.

Those coming from New Bedford will be re-directed to Rte. 18 and I-195.

Those coming from Fairhaven will need to go towards Howland and Coggeshall Streets.

The estimated completion date for the paving is May 26th.

Officials say the closures are being put in place so crews can complete milling and paving work on the roadway.
